1. The present contempt petition has been filed alleging willful disobedience of the order dated 13th September, 2019 in W.P.(C) No. 2456/2019, wherein the parties had arrived at a settlement after they had been referred to the Delhi High Court Mediation and Conciliation Centre, by virtue of Settlement Agreement dated 24th July, 2019.
2. As per the terms of the said agreement, the petitioner was entitled to payment of Rs. 10,50,000/- by respondent no. 1 company. It was further noted in the Settlement that the said amount of Rs. 10,50,000/- shall be paid to the petitioner herein in five installments.
3. The Court vide order dated 13th September, 2019 had directed that in case there was a delay in making the payment to the petitioner, then the same shall carry interest at the rate of 9% per annum. The order dated 13th September, 2019 passed in W.P.(C) No. 2456/2019, reads as under:
